Subjonctif Passé (Subjunctive Past) Tense Conjugation of the French Verb dégeler
Introduction to the verb dégeler
The English translation of the French verb dégeler is “to defrost” or “to thaw.” It is pronounced as “day-zhel-ay.”
Dégeler comes from the combination of the prefix “dé-” meaning “undo” or “reverse” and the verb “geler” meaning “to freeze.” It is most often used in everyday French when talking about the process of thawing or defrosting something, such as food or a frozen surface.
In the Subjonctif Passé tense, dégeler is used to express a wish, hypothetical situation, or uncertainty about an action that has already happened. It is formed by using the subjunctive form of the auxiliary verb “avoir” or “être” followed by the past participle of dégeler.
Here are three simple examples of dégeler in the Subjonctif Passé tense:
- J’aurais aimé que tu aies dégelé le poulet avant de le cuire. (I would have liked for you to have defrosted the chicken before cooking it.)
- Il est possible que le lac se soit dégelé après ces températures plus chaudes. (It is possible that the lake has thawed after these warmer temperatures.)
- Nous doutons qu’ils aient dégelé les fonds pour la nouvelle école. (We doubt that they have unfrozen the funds for the new school.)
Table of the Subjonctif Passé (Subjunctive Past) Tense Conjugation of dégeler
Pronoun | Conjugation | Example Usage | English Translation |
---|---|---|---|
je | aie dégelé | Il faut que je l’aie dégelé. | I must have thawed it. |
tu | aies dégelé | Je doute que tu aies dégelé le réfrigérateur. | I doubt you thawed the fridge. |
il | ait dégelé | Il est possible qu’il ait dégelé la viande. | It’s possible he thawed the meat. |
elle | ait dégelé | Elle a peur qu’elle ait dégelé les légumes. | She’s afraid she thawed the vegetables. |
on | ait dégelé | On veut qu’on ait dégelé la glace. | We want the ice to have been thawed. |
nous | ayons dégelé | Nous espérons que nous l’ayons dégelé. | We hope we thawed it. |
vous | ayez dégelé | Il est important que vous l’ayez dégelé. | It’s important that you thawed it. |
ils | aient dégelé | Ils doutent qu’ils aient dégelé la voiture. | They doubt they thawed the car. |
elles | aient dégelé | Elles préfèrent qu’elles l’aient dégelé. | They prefer they thawed it. |
